    3D stacking and truck loading in AutoCAD for optimized transport

    When it comes to offsite timber construction, efficient truck loading can make or break a project. A well-planned loading strategy can reduce material handling, prevent damage during transport, minimize installation errors, and ensure timely delivery of your prefabricated elements to the construction site.

    3D stacking and truck loading in AutoCAD for efficient timber construction transport and installation

    Our new 3D stacking and truck loading solution helps ensure that each of your elements arrives at the right time, in the right order, and ready for immediate assembly with three new features:

    1. StackItem

    StackItem enables you to prepare individual items for loading by pre-filtering and sorting timber elements. This simplifies the organization of materials according to project specifications, streamlining the journey from design to manufacturing.

    2. StackPack

    StackPack allows you to group sorted items into packs, with information synchronized back to the model for real-time updates. This ensures consistency between your digital models and physical materials throughout the process.

    3. StackEntity

    StackEntity is the final “loading unit” where your items and packs are assembled onto designated trucks or loading entities. This feature allows for detailed transport planning, enabling you to optimize your space and minimize the adjustments needed at the job site.

    The result? Increased project accuracy and efficiency, with fewer transport errors, optimized space usage, and a more streamlined site assembly.

    hsbAIBodyAnalyzer (Proof of Concept) for AI-powered body analysis

    Take your IFC imports to the next level with hsbAIBodyAnalyzer (Proof of Concept), a first-of-its-kind AI-powered tool designed to streamline body analysis. Leveraging advanced AI, this tool integrates seamlessly with the IFC Import Manager, enhancing how you handle and analyze construction elements.

    The new capabilities include:

    1. Automated tool detection

    The hsbAIBodyAnalyzer (Proof of Concept) can accurately identify a variety of tools, including Dove (Male/Female), Tenon (Male/Female), Drill, Cone, and X-Fix. Incorporating this information to the imported model makes exported files richer and CNC machine-ready.

    2. Smart Validation

    Our confidence-based acceptance feature enables automatic validation of recognized tools. Tools detected with a certain confidence level are marked in green for easy identification, and once a tool is confirmed either automatically by the system or manually by the user, it’s displayed in blue.

    hsbAIBodyAnalyzer in hsbDesign for AutoCAD

    It’s also possible to refine the toolset with intuitive manual adjustments, giving designers and engineers complete control over the final tool selections.

    Customizable Fastener Database for increased reliability

    Our new Fastener Database is a preloaded library that brings fasteners from top manufacturers like Simpson Strong-Tie, Rothoblaas, Heco, Klimas, and more directly into your workflow. This resource enhances the reliability of timber construction projects by providing access to trusted, industry-standard components that ensure durability and performance.

    Beyond the preloaded options, you can also tailor your Fastener Database to meet the needs of different projects:

    • Adding fasteners manually

    • Uploading custom fastener data

    • Selecting ideal components for specific timber assemblies

    Precise and accurate fastener specifications are essential for securing and maintaining structural integrity in offsite timber construction. This makes having a comprehensive fastener database key to ensuring that materials are securely assembled to meet both design and structural requirements.

    Additional upgrades for enhanced control and functionality

    1. Assembly Definition

    The Assembly Definition feature enables users to group multiple objects, including beams, sheets, metal parts, and more, into cohesive units. It significantly streamlines production planning, shop drawing creation, and property analysis, optimizing the manufacturing process and reducing the time from design to assembly.

    2. Enhanced collision control

    Our improved Check Construction feature now includes architectural components like windows, doors, and mass elements, ensuring prefabricated timber elements align perfectly with other building components and reducing on-site adjustments.

    3. Clearer dimension lines

    The new dimension offset mode improves the clarity and precision of dimension lines in timber cut plans. This key enhancement makes designs easier to interpret and implement, ensuring that the prefabrication process is both accurate and efficient. These features work together to support the modular nature of offsite timber construction, helping to ensure accuracy from design through assembly.

    The Ascent

    The Ascent, recognized as the world's tallest timber hybrid building, is an excellent example of hsbDesign for AutoCAD®'s building potential. The software was pivotal in managing and integrating the complex elements that brought this incredible structure to life.

    Developed with our long-time partner KLH, this 25-story building combines post-tensioned concrete with mass timber construction, featuring 259 luxury apartments and 7,000 square feet of retail space.

    “hsbcad's solutions were instrumental in the 'The Ascent' project, providing precise modeling of the entire CLT scope, which was essential for the construction's accuracy. Their advanced software enabled the creation of detailed single-piece drawings, ensuring efficient and flawless assembly. Additionally, hsbcad's transport loading diagrams optimized logistics, contributing significantly to the successful realization of the world's highest timber hybrid building.” - KLH

    In 2023, The Ascent earned the prestigious “Wood Design Award” and “Structure Award” from the Council on Tall Buildings and Urban Habitat (CTBUH), recognizing its exceptional design and structural engineering.
